Message type: E = Error
Message class: SWLT - Message Class for ... guess!
Message number: 005
Message text: Coverage evaluation for destination &1 failed: &2&3&4

- Coverage evaluation for destination &1 failed: &2&3&4 ?The SAP error message SWLT005 indicates that there was a failure in the coverage evaluation for a specific destination. This error typically arises in the context of SAP's Workflow and Business Process Management (BPM) functionalities, particularly when dealing with workflow tasks and their assignments.
Cause:
The error message SWLT005 can be caused by several factors, including:
- Configuration Issues: The destination specified in the error message may not be correctly configured in the system.
- Missing or Incorrect Data: There may be missing or incorrect data related to the workflow or the task that is being evaluated.
- Authorization Problems: The user or system may not have the necessary authorizations to access the required data or perform the evaluation.
-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as problems with the workflow definition or the system's ability to process the evaluation.
Solution:
To resolve the SWLT005 error, you can take the following steps:
Check Configuration: Verify that the destination specified in the error message is correctly configured. This includes checking the workflow settings and ensuring that all necessary parameters are set up correctly.
Review Workflow Definitions: Ensure that the workflow definitions are complete and correctly defined. Look for any missing steps or incorrect configurations that could lead to evaluation failures.
Check Data Integrity: Review the data associated with the workflow task. Ensure that all required fields are populated and that the data is valid.
Authorization Check: Ensure that the user or system has the necessary authorizations to perform the coverage evaluation. You may need to adjust roles or permissions accordingly.
System Logs: Check the system logs (transaction SLG1) for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the failure.
SAP Notes: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address this specific error. There may be patches or updates available that resolve known issues.
Testing: After making changes, test the workflow again to see if the issue has been resolved.
